   1        This is at least a partial credits-file of people that have
   2        contributed to the Linux project.  It is sorted by name and
   3        formatted to allow easy grepping and beautification by
   4        scripts.  The fields are: name (N), email (E), web-address
   5        (W), PGP key ID and fingerprint (P), description (D), and
   6        snail-mail address (S).
